A metre stick is balanced on a knife edge at its centre. When two coins, each of mass 5 g are put one on top of the other at the 12.0 cm mark, the stick is found to be balanced at 45.0 cm. What is the mass of the metre stick?

Open in App
Solution



The mass of the stick is concentrated at 50cm that is the midpoint of the stick.

Let the mass of the stick be, m

Let the mass of the coin is, 5g

When one coin is shifted by 12cm towards point Pthen the second coin is shifted towards centre by 5cmand the centre of mass gets shifted.

The net torque acting will be conserved for the rotational motion about point R.

10×( 4512 )gmg(5045)=0

m= 330 5 g

Hence the mass is 66g
